您的位置:首页 >智能 >

电脑怎么开始运行软件了(电脑软件启动原理)

时间:2023-12-15 22:09:19 来源:互联网

在使用电脑时,我们经常会启动各种应用程序,但是很少有人会去思考电脑是如何开始运行软件的。其实,电脑软件启动有着一定的原理和流程。

1.操作系统的作用

操作系统是电脑启动软件的重要环节。它负责管理计算机硬件和软件资源,为其他软件提供接口。在打开软件时,我们实际上是在操作系统中运行程序。

2.执行软件的CPU

CPU是电脑运行软件的核心部件。当我们打开软件时,CPU接收来自操作系统的指令,将这些指令翻译成计算机可以理解的机器指令,并对其进行处理。

3.软件加载过程

软件加载是一个复杂的过程,它包括搜索文件、分配内存、加载DLL库等多个步骤。在软件加载时,电脑会像一个工厂一样,逐步完成不同的生产环节,最终启动软件。

4.软件的依赖关系

很多软件依赖其他软件或库文件,例如.NETFramework、JavaRuntimeEnvironment等。因此,当我们启动一个软件时,电脑需要先加载这些软件库文件,然后才能正常运行软件。

5.电脑性能对软件运行的影响

电脑的性能直接影响软件的运行效果。当计算机性能不足时,软件可能会运行缓慢、崩溃或无法启动。因此,升级硬件或优化系统设置是提高软件运行效果的重要方法。

6.软件启动优化

为了提高软件启动速度,我们可以对电脑进行相应的优化。比如,关闭开机启动项、优化硬盘空间、升级驱动程序等。这些操作都可以有效地提升软件运行的效率。

电脑启动软件其实是一个复杂的过程,需要操作系统、CPU、软件库文件、电脑性能等多个因素的组合作用。只有了解了这些原理,我们才能更好地理解电脑软件启动的流程,同时也能为我们优化电脑软件的运行效果提供指导。


郑重声明:文章仅代表原作者观点,不代表本站立场;如有侵权、违规,可直接反馈本站,我们将会作修改或删除处理。